Output d5d4e2894fdd1c0341db9bc21e81a2b5a6dca7f20996d2b7f2820a9a65e60ad5:0

value
19883809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d400e3773e884fd7fa592f98898c730a5a6572d OP_EQUAL
address
32u5ShD3XPG82trhPjDxqrrYjLQD18a2zZ
transaction
d5d4e2894fdd1c0341db9bc21e81a2b5a6dca7f20996d2b7f2820a9a65e60ad5
confirmations
256301
spent
true